    The sixth-seeded South Carolina Gamecocks (26-7) will take on the No. 11 seeded Oregon Ducks (23-11) in an NCAA Tournament Midwest Region matchup on Thursday at 4 p.m. ET at PPG Paints Arena in Pittsburgh. Oregon is a 1.5-point favorite in the latest Oregon vs. South Carolina odds via SportsLine consensus, while the over/under for total points scored is 134 (see up-to-date odds for every game this week on our college basketball odds page).

    The model knows the Gamecocks are led by junior guard Meechie Johnson, who has reached double-digit scoring 21 times in 2023-24. He scored a season-high 29 points, while grabbing five rebounds in a 65-53 win over Notre Dame on Nov. 28. He poured in 25 points, while grabbing four rebounds and dishing out three assists in an 82-76 win over Florida on March 2. In 32 games, all starts, Johnson is averaging 13.8 points, 4.2 rebounds and 2.9 assists in 28.9 minutes.

    The model also knows senior center N'Faly Dante appears to be peaking at just the right time for the Ducks. In the Pac-12 Tournament championship game, he nearly registered a double-double as he poured in 25 points and nine rebounds in 32 minutes of action in a 75-68 win over Colorado. He had 14 points and 10 rebounds in a 67-59 upset win over top-seeded Arizona in the semifinals. He opened the Pac-12 Tournament with a 22-point, six-rebound and four-assist performance in a 68-65 quarterfinal victory over UCLA.
